Buying Over-the-Counter Painkillers in Spain: A Comprehensive Guide
When traveling or residing in Spain, whether for leisure or work, understanding how to browse the local pharmacy scene is necessary— particularly if you discover yourself in requirement of over-the-counter pain relief. This article will work as a guide to buying over-the-counter (OTC) pain relievers in Spain, detailing the types readily available, where to buy them, and responding to some common concerns.
Comprehending Over-the-Counter Painkillers
Non-prescription pain relievers are medications that can be acquired without a prescription. They are frequently utilized to minimize a range of pains and discomforts, such as headaches, muscle pain, and minor injuries. In Spain, the OTC pain relievers available are rather comparable to those found in other nations, but the brand might differ.

Where to Buy Over-the-Counter Painkillers in Spain
In Spain, OTC pain relievers can be acquired from different places:
Farmacias (Pharmacies): Pharmacies are the most common locations to purchase OTC medications in Spain. In bigger cities, you will discover a drug store practically on every corner. Pharmacists are experienced and can recommend proper medications based on your symptoms.
Supermarkets and Convenience Stores: Some larger grocery stores, such as Mercadona or Carrefour, bring a restricted selection of OTC pain relievers in their health aisles. Corner store might likewise equip basic painkiller.
Online Pharmacies: The online pharmacy market in Spain is growing. Websites like FarmaciaOnline or Mymarca offer a selection of OTC medications that can be delivered straight to your home.
Health Food Stores: Some organic food stores and organic markets might likewise bring natural pain relief choices, consisting of organic remedies and supplements.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ION
1. Can I buy prescription medications over-the-counter in Spain?
No, prescription medications can not be acquired without a valid prescription from a registered physician.
2. Are there any age restrictions for purchasing OTC painkillers in Spain?
Normally, there are no age restrictions for purchasing OTC pain relievers. Nevertheless, specific medications may have recommendations for age limitations, particularly for children.
3. What should I do if I experience negative effects?

4. Exist any OTC painkillers that I should avoid?
While the majority of OTC painkillers are safe for general use, people with specific medical conditions (such as ulcers, liver concerns, or certain allergies) need to prevent specific painkiller. Constantly seek advice from a pharmacist if uncertain.
